70 NOVA with 6.0
What will it run,my combo is stock LQ4 short block,lunati cam with 244 duration @ .050 and .609 lift on intake and exhaust with 112 lobe sep,L92 heads out the box no port work,carb intake with 850 holley,msd box to fire coil packs,1 3/4 headers with 3 inch exhaust and flowmasters,powerglide 4500 converter with trans brake,513 gears with 29x9 slick,car weighs 3300 with me in it.The same set up with 355c.i. solid roller ran 7.0 sold that mtor to try this ls stuff out,I am hoping for around the same numbers but with pump gas.Any info will be appreciated.

Should go low 11's in the 1/4mi easy. Not sure what that calculates into in the 1/8mi though? I think it might be in the same range. Toss a lil spray at it and it should break into the 10's with a small shot (75-100)

Yeah I might have to toss the 513's for some 411's I have a set of them just in case,the small block I had in it I was shifting at 7600 but it also made it through the eighth on a 325 shot with a big shot plate,it ran 6.18 @114 but it was @ 8000 through the lights.It actually slowed down with 411's with that motor,the reason I think it works better is because the 1.76 first gear of the glide.I think I will be shifting this motor around 6500 to 6800.
